The European political climate in the late 1700s and early 1800s, according to European Feminisms 1700-1950, was one where the idea of women having anywhere close to equal rights with men was a present, developed concept, but not widely supported by the general population whose ideologies were based in traditional gender roles (Offen, 2000). 32844. In a feminist context, Elizabeths primary role within the novel is to expose the way in which women are viewed and treated by men and society as a whole: submissive, docile, and present for the sole purpose of mens pleasure and convenience. Women in the novel are also shown as weak and as objects through Justine and Safie, as both were used as either a scapegoat or a tool by men. When the term "feminist text" comes to mind in regard to literature, we typically think of a novel with a strong female lead. This is a pointer that women are caring just like nature itself. Elizabeths part in the Monsters vengeance acts as a metaphor to reveal the extent to which she was seen merely as a possession, continuously portrayed as an item in the life of the men she is acquainted with. Feminism in Frankenstein Although her mother died when she was 10 days old, as stated in Was Mary Shelley a Feminist, Her mother was none other than Mary Wollstonecraft, a pioneer of feminist thought at a time when women were considered, at best, property.
